The concept of intellectual property encompasses various forms, including patents, copyrights, trademarks, and trade secrets. In this digital landscape, creators must navigate complexities such as online piracy, content misattribution, and the unique challenges posed by artificial intelligence. A key trend emerges from this shift: the need for more nuanced legal frameworks that address digital content creation, distribution, and consumption. Copyright law must adapt to accommodate the unique challenges posed by online platforms and remote collaboration. For example, identifying ownership rights in collaborative projects within virtual spaces becomes increasingly complex. Additionally, the rise of open-source communities and user-generated content raises questions about fair use and copyright limitations. Legal professionals and scholars must collaborate closely with policymakers to interpret and update existing laws effectively.

Research into copyright law in 2025 should focus on several critical areas. First, exploring methods for enhancing digital watermarking techniques can help deter unauthorized distribution of copyrighted material. Second, studying blockchain technology’s role in content verification and ownership tracking is a promising avenue. Moreover, examining case law from recent years will reveal emerging trends and precedents in handling copyright disputes related to online platforms. For instance, platforms hosting user-generated content like educational videos or interactive games require robust policies and mechanisms to protect creators’ rights.

One key aspect is understanding the legal framework governing IP in the digital context. Traditional methods of copyright protection, for instance, often struggle to keep pace with online piracy and unauthorized distribution. In response, many jurisdictions are refining their laws to better address these modern issues. For example, utilizing advanced tracking technologies and digital watermarks can aid in identifying and tracing infringers, providing a more robust legal foundation for IP holders. Furthermore, international cooperation is essential; harmonizing IP laws globally will facilitate cross-border protection and enforcement, especially as people and content traverse digital borders effortlessly.

Practical insights for IP owners include proactive measures such as registering works with relevant digital platforms and utilizing automated tools to monitor online activity.
